Output d6fd4ece2860b300f5152cbae7ff0b477048dd95af6a9eeec2679d2ca515c45a:2

value
1920969045
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63629e2c470887307861bcb47589e5e776dcfad2c8b794ad1fd561bf6f3935ac
address
tb1pvd3futz8pzrnq7rphj68tz09uamde7kjezmeftgl64sm7meexkkqrpn8kv
transaction
d6fd4ece2860b300f5152cbae7ff0b477048dd95af6a9eeec2679d2ca515c45a
confirmations
64031
spent
true